The transition from Mark Murphy to Ed Policy as the Packers CEO and president will be formalized at the annual shareholders meeting on July 25.
GREEN BAY – Ed Policy, the Green Bay Packers chief operating officer, will succeed the retiring Mark Murphy as president and CEO of the franchise next month. Policy will assume the position ...
The Packers are the only team in the NFL owned by fans. The organization has more than 539,000 shareholders owning about 5.2 million shares. Proxy materials will be sent to shareholders in mid-June.
